i know what your saying but you'd be surprised by how many can bypass that process by bugs in forums and xss stuff (cross site scripting). forum creators often release updates to do with stuff like that. i recall all this kinda stuff from doing my own forum and if i didn't apply updates now and again, it would get infested with bots and such.

Many forums do that question thing and bots can be programed with correct responses which look for keywords. like with your example it'll probably look for "days" and "year" and match that up to a list of possible answers. many times it'll fail to make an account, but now and again it'll get one through. the fact that only this one has slipped the net shows how well the system is working for us, but now and again, one will get through. I used to use a combination of things, like making it a requirement to select if your male or female via a click on a radio button, and question thing as well, but there are some types of bots where someone will go to your registration page and just look at what it takes to signup once, program it into the bot, and the bots signup every now and again
